The History and Myth of the Animas River
The Animas River has a rich history and is steeped in myth and legend. The river was named "El Rio de las Animas Perdidas" by Spanish explorers, which translates to "The River of Lost Souls." According to local legends, the river got its name from the spirits of Native Americans who perished along its banks.
Historically, the Animas River played a significant role in the development of the region. It was a vital waterway for Native American tribes, who used it for transportation, fishing, and irrigation. Later, during the mining boom in the late 19th century, the river became a source of water for mining operations.
Today, the Animas River is a popular destination for outdoor enthusiasts, offering activities such as white water rafting, fishing, and hiking. The river's rich history and mythical past add to its allure, making it a truly unique and captivating destination.

Recommendations for White Water Rafting on the Animas River
When planning your white water rafting adventure on the Animas River, there are a few recommendations to keep in mind:
1. Choose the right level of difficulty: The Animas River offers rapids ranging from Class I to Class V. Make sure to choose a level that matches your skill and comfort level. If you are a beginner, start with Class I or II rapids and gradually work your way up.
2. Dress appropriately: Wear comfortable, quick-drying clothing that can get wet. Avoid cotton as it retains water and can make you feel colder. Don't forget to pack sunscreen, a hat, and sunglasses to protect yourself from the sun.
3. Listen to your guide: The tour guides are experienced professionals who know the river inside out. Listen to their instructions and follow their guidance to ensure a safe and enjoyable experience.
4. Bring a waterproof camera: Capture the memories of your white water rafting adventure by bringing a waterproof camera. Just make sure it is securely attached to your person or the raft to prevent it from getting lost in the rapids.

White Water Rafting on the Animas River: Tips for a Successful Adventure
White water rafting on the Animas River can be an exhilarating and unforgettable experience. To ensure a successful adventure, here are a few tips to keep in mind:
1. Choose the right time of year: The best time for white water rafting on the Animas River is typically from May to September when the water levels are higher. This ensures more challenging rapids and a more thrilling experience.
2. Be prepared: Before embarking on your rafting adventure, make sure you are physically prepared. Rafting can be physically demanding, so it is essential to be in good health and have a reasonable level of fitness.
3. Stay hydrated: During your rafting trip, it is crucial to stay hydrated. Bring plenty of water and drink regularly to prevent dehydration. The combination of physical exertion and sun exposure can quickly deplete your body's water levels.
4. Don't forget the essentials: In addition to water, pack snacks, sunscreen, a hat, and sunglasses. These items will help keep you nourished, protected from the sun, and comfortable throughout your adventure.
5. Listen to your guide: Your guide is there to ensure your safety and provide an enjoyable experience. Listen to their instructions, ask questions if you are unsure, and follow their guidance throughout the trip.
